WebbIn the UK this is known as a PGCE (Postgraduate Certificate in Education), which is a minimum requirement to pursue a career as a teacher. You can only undergo the PGCE process if you already have a Bachelor's degree, meaning that it requires 4 years worth of higher education. WebbThe majority of Canadian teachers coming to the UK have a tier 5 youth mobility visa. These are only available to teachers under the age of but will allow you to live and work in the UK for up to 2 years. Otherwise you need to have a British or EU passport, British ancestry or be eligible for a tier 2 sponsor visa.
